+GoldenWheels Posted December 8, 2017 Share Posted December 8, 2017 ***SOLD*** I was very curious about a NES clone in a 7800 case. My curiosity has been sated and I am ready to find it a good home with another collector. System is fully functional. It is PAL-M format. It does display and run games on NTSC TVs, but does so only in black & white. Has both Composite and RF outs, however I have only used the Composite out. The 3 games included are F-15 City War, Crimebusters, and Ghostbusters (you may note someone wrote Double Dragon 2 over the rip on the Ghostbusters label--it is Ghostbusters, NOT DD2.) All games work. Also comes with one controller, light gun and the appropriate power adapter with US plug converter. Light gun works with Crimebusters, and must be plugged into controller port 2 to work. When I received the system, both it and the controller were disassembled and cleaned thoroughly inside and out.
